Output ed598df23cb86c85e221df2696ea1f812baf6be6b997cd0f0e0be608ce3100ac:4

value
1379463
script pubkey
OP_0 OP_PUSHBYTES_20 84470a50d7ff8e4be0f65a128cd01b5d7d2ee982
address
bc1qs3rs55xhl78yhc8ktgfge5qmt47ja6vzh0lg9g
transaction
ed598df23cb86c85e221df2696ea1f812baf6be6b997cd0f0e0be608ce3100ac
spent
true